黃玲娜
摘要: 學生畢業(yè)之后仍然需要知識更新和繼續(xù)提高,而為他們提供培訓機會的大多是社會辦學機構,因此,高職院校有必要建立網絡繼續(xù)教育系統(tǒng)為畢業(yè)生提供繼續(xù)學習、更新知識的平臺。利用ASP技術、網絡技術、網站開發(fā)技術等能快速開發(fā)這樣一個系統(tǒng)平臺,為學生提供繼續(xù)學習機會的同時,提高學校自身的競爭力。
關鍵詞: 繼續(xù)教育; 網站開發(fā); ASP技術; 網絡技術
中圖分類號:TP311.52文獻標志碼:A 文章編號:1006-8228(2012)11-64-02
Research of continuing education web site in university
Huang Lingna1,2
(1. Jiangnan University, Wuxi, Jiangsu 214000, China; 2. Wuxi Higher Normal School)
Abstract: Students who have graduated also need to update and increase knowledge, but the ones who provide continuing education training are often social institutions. The establishment of network system of higher vocational colleges continuing education has become an indispensable link to supply a stage for learning and updating knowledge. The system of development and construction can be realized by using ASP technology, network technology, and web development technology. The site will not only enable students to achieve life-long education, but also improve the competitiveness of the school.
Key words: continuing education; ASP technology; network technology
0 引言
在新形勢下,高職院校的畢業(yè)生踏上工作崗位后,仍然需要知識更新和繼續(xù)提高,而為他們提供培訓機會的大部分是社會培訓機構,作為我國教育事業(yè)重要組成部分的高職院校卻很少關注本校畢業(yè)生畢業(yè)之后的繼續(xù)教育問題。西方發(fā)達國家的高職院校都很注重普通教育與成人教育同步發(fā)展,而我國大部分高職院校卻只把注意力放在職前教育上,職后的繼續(xù)教育往往被忽視掉了。其實高職院校具有穩(wěn)定、優(yōu)質的師資力量、規(guī)范的管理制度和良好的教學環(huán)境,而且高職院校的繼續(xù)教育往往比起普通的社會辦學機構更加能令人信服,因此如果高職院校能夠從畢業(yè)生的實際需求出發(fā),為畢業(yè)生提供繼續(xù)教育機會,不僅可以滿足畢業(yè)生的實際需求,也可以提高學校的競爭力。目前網絡教育的發(fā)展十分的迅速,發(fā)展網絡教育產業(yè)具有重要意義[1]:可以更加接近教育平等的目標,改善人才市場結構,緩解就業(yè)壓力,擴大內需,優(yōu)化經濟產業(yè)結構。
1 系統(tǒng)功能分析
高校網絡繼續(xù)教育系統(tǒng)分為七大功能模塊,每個模塊的功能如圖1所示。
⑴ 學員模塊
畢業(yè)生首次登錄遠程繼續(xù)教育系統(tǒng),首先要作為網校的新生進行入學注冊,新生注冊需要填寫畢業(yè)證書的號碼(一個號碼僅能注冊一次),注冊成功之后,可以選擇要學習的課程,學生憑借學號和密碼才可以進行學習、答疑、作業(yè)和測試。學校對于畢業(yè)一年內的學生繼續(xù)教育是免費的,滿一年之后再根據相關政策收取一定的培訓費。
[高校繼續(xù)教育網站][教學資源管理\&][學院管理\&][教師管理\&][測試設計\&][自主學習\&][師生交流答疑\&][教務管理\&]
圖1高校網絡繼續(xù)教育系統(tǒng)總體結構圖
⑵ 教師模塊
該模塊主要進行教師資源的管理,包括新增教師信息、查詢教師資料、查看學生對教師的評價結果等等。
⑶ 教學資源模塊
教學資源是否符合需要、是否豐富是一個教育網站建設必須首先考慮的重點。系統(tǒng)應該具有教學資源的上傳、更新、刪除、修改等管理功能。教學資源不僅僅是指上課用的教學幻燈片、教學視頻等資料,還有與課程有關的相關論文、文獻等資源,這些教學資源由任課教師上傳至本資源庫,供有興趣的學生課外參考研究。
⑷ 學習模塊
網絡繼續(xù)教育系統(tǒng)的教學主要是一種自主學習方式,這也是遠程教育系統(tǒng)區(qū)別于普通學校教育的一個重要方面。自主學習系統(tǒng)的教學模式通常有多種方式。例如:學員登錄系統(tǒng)后下載服務器上的教學資源進行學習,這種方式通常首先由任課老師或管理員將事先制作好的多媒體課件或視頻上傳到網絡服務器上,學生隨時隨地可以通過網絡訪問這些電子教材,實現(xiàn)自我學習的目的;又如:利用在線視頻課堂,一般預先在網站上通知學員視頻課堂的具體時間,然后在指定的時間里,由教師進行現(xiàn)場授課,授課內容通過網絡通訊設備進行實時播放,學員則登錄系統(tǒng)后通過網絡視頻軟件觀看上課的內容,在這一過程中學員可與上課教師通過文字或語音的方式實時交流,達到教學的目的。
⑸ 交流模塊
網絡繼續(xù)教育的教學模式是教與學分離的,因此答疑子系統(tǒng)也是網絡繼續(xù)教育系統(tǒng)不可缺少的一個重要組成部分。學生在自主學習過程中難免會遇到各種各樣的問題,但是又不可能與教師面對面地進行交流,因此設置一個答疑交流模塊可以使師生互動,也有利于教師對學生的學習效果進行跟蹤檢查。在實際的運用中,學生可以通過聊天室、討論區(qū)等方式與在線的其他同學或老師進行交流。
⑹ 測試模塊
檢測教學效果的常用手段就是考試,本系統(tǒng)的測試模塊以學生的自主測試為主。當學生通過系統(tǒng)學習了相關課程之后,可以通過系統(tǒng)中的測試模塊進行自我測試以檢查學習的效果。
⑺ 教務模塊
教務管理系統(tǒng)的功能進行綜合管理,對學員的學習活動過程進行跟蹤,記錄學員的學習歷程。
2 主要采用的技術
2.1 B/S模式
傳統(tǒng)的客戶機(Client)/服務器(Server)模式存在靈活性差、升級困難、維護工作量大等缺陷,特別是需要在客戶端安裝應用程序之后才能工作,因此已經難以適應實際需求。而隨著Internet的廣泛使用,Web技術也日益成熟,瀏覽器(Browser)/服務器(Server)結構已成為取代客戶機(Client)/服務器(Server)的一種全新技術。因此本系統(tǒng)的開發(fā)模式采用瀏覽器(Browser)/服務器(Server)模式,采用該結構的優(yōu)勢如下[2]:
⑴ 無須開發(fā)客戶端軟件,維護和升級方便;
⑵ 可跨平臺操作,任何一臺機器只要裝有www瀏覽器軟件,均可作為客戶機來訪問系統(tǒng);
⑶ 具有良好的開放性和可擴充性:
⑷ 可采用防火墻技術來保證系統(tǒng)的安全性,有效地適應了當前用戶對管理信息系統(tǒng)的新需求。因此該結構在管理信息系統(tǒng)開發(fā)領域中獲得飛速發(fā)展,成為應用軟件研制中一種流行的體系結構。
2.2 DreamWeaver網頁制作工具
DreamWeaver是目前市場上非常流行的一種網頁開發(fā)設計工具,它提供了一種所見即所得的、可視化的開發(fā)環(huán)境,同時也支持代碼編程,DreamWeaver支持ASP、ASP.net、JSP、PHP等技術。用戶使用該系列的軟件可以非常方便地在網頁中插入各種對象(圖片、文字、動畫等)。
Dreamweaver最出色的地方在于,其具備動態(tài)服務器網頁的可視化設置功能,同時對各類平臺與服務器語言提供足夠的支持,無論是PHP、JSP、ASP,還是ASP.NET,程序設計人員均能夠通過設置,利用Dreamweaver的單一接口,設計不同類型的動態(tài)服務器網頁[3]。
2.3 ASP技術
ASP技術的全稱是Active Server Pages,譯成中文是動態(tài)服務器網頁,它是由微軟公司推出的一款開發(fā)動態(tài)網頁的強大工具。ASP指的是在Windows系統(tǒng)中運行的Web服務器(WebServer)所能利用的服務器(Server)端的Script環(huán)境,ASP并不是一種計算機編程語言,而是一種編寫服務器腳本的環(huán)境。ASP具有無限可擴充性,可以使用Visual Basic、Java、Visual C++等編程語言來編寫,另外,采用ASP技術無須Compile編譯,編寫容易,且可以在服務器端直接執(zhí)行[4]。
3 系統(tǒng)設計
3.1 數(shù)據庫設計
數(shù)據庫設計的目標是建立一個合適的數(shù)據模型 ,一般來說,數(shù)據庫設計的步驟可分為概念結構設計、邏輯結構設計和物理結構設計三個階段。由于本系統(tǒng)是網絡教育系統(tǒng),因此數(shù)據庫設計要滿足一定的網絡要求:數(shù)據查詢時簡單、快速,網絡數(shù)據流量小,同時具有良好的安全性和可用性[5]。下面主要介紹邏輯結構設計,邏輯結構設計的主要任務是根據概念設計來設計系統(tǒng)的邏輯模型。本系統(tǒng)用到的主要的邏輯模型如下所示:
學員(學號,姓名,出生年月,入學時間,畢業(yè)證號碼,密碼,性別,聯(lián)系電話)
教師(教師號,教師名,性別,職稱,聯(lián)系電話,專業(yè))
課程(課程號,課程名,開課時間,學分)
教學資源(資源號,資源名,上傳時間,上傳者編號,課程類別,任課教師,存儲位置)
學員選課(學生號,課程號,成績)
教師課表(教師號,課程號,人數(shù))
學習進度表(學號,資源號,章號,節(jié)號,瀏覽時間,掌握情況)
作業(yè)(學號,作業(yè)號,內容,遞交時間,成績,批改否)
試卷(試卷編號,題號,題型,題目描述,分值,答案)
答卷(試卷編號,學號,題型,題號,對錯,得分)
答疑(學號,問題號,提交時間,是否解答,問題內容,回答內容,回答人)
3.2 詳細設計
詳細設計的主要目的是建立起系統(tǒng)的各個功能模塊,這就需要進行程序設計。
注冊系統(tǒng)的界面如圖2所示。下面以注冊系統(tǒng)為例,簡單描述學員登錄系統(tǒng)的代碼設計,代碼片段如下:
n=request.form(“name”)
pdl=request.form(“passwdl”)
pd2=request.form(“passwd2”)
if (pdl=pd2)then
set Conn=server.createobject(“adodb.connection”)
Conn.Open ”driver={SQL server):server=pcl61:uid=sa;
pwd=:database=asDdata”
sl=”select n from [register] where n=”&n&”
set rec=server.createobject(“adodb.recordset”)
rec.open Sl,conn,3,3
if rec.eof then
sl=”insert into[register](n,password)
values(‘”&n&”,”&pdl&”)
conn.execute Sl
response.write “注冊成功,請妥善保管您的用戶名和密碼”
else
response.write “對不起,用戶名已經被他人占用,請重新輸入”
end if
else response.write “您兩次輸入的密碼不同,請重新輸入”
end if
4 結束語
實踐表明,采用DreamWeaver和ASP作為系統(tǒng)前臺的開發(fā),利用SQL2000數(shù)據庫,就能實現(xiàn)高校網絡繼續(xù)教育系統(tǒng)的各種功能。如今網絡教育已經成為我國教育事業(yè)的一個重要組成部分,現(xiàn)有的技術、環(huán)境完全能夠支持開發(fā)該系統(tǒng),高職院校利用這樣的系統(tǒng)不僅可以實現(xiàn)對學生的終身教育,而且可順應社會發(fā)展的趨勢,提高自身競爭力,故值得推廣。
圖2注冊系統(tǒng)界面圖
參考文獻:
[1] 劉曄.網絡教育產業(yè)發(fā)展模式研究[D].首都經濟貿易大學碩士學位論
文,2008.
[2] 劉新晨.基于Internet的網絡繼續(xù)教育系統(tǒng)[D].大連理工大學碩士學
位論文,2006.
[3] 王娟.基于ASP與Dreamweaver數(shù)據庫網站的開發(fā)[J].制造業(yè)自動
化,2010.32(6):126
[4] 胡秀源.基于ASP技術的動態(tài)網站設計[J].制造業(yè)自動化,2011.33
(3):205
[5] 郭智華.網絡教學系統(tǒng)中數(shù)據庫的設計與分析[J].江蘇大學學報,
2006.27(5A):71